Output 7d23a26658750bbda359dddf721a7c5a43303c4d84930b4a4203493646871d60:0

value
2130318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3dbf5d925824f5ac5bee840bcd0eb691306f4c OP_EQUAL
address
M97AzDYDnUZa9siXuikUfATrBDQWgd2RvS
transaction
7d23a26658750bbda359dddf721a7c5a43303c4d84930b4a4203493646871d60
spent
true